Tal Y Llyn The Eliminator Swimrun

The Eliminator Swimrun at Tal Y Llyn, with 36% of swimming, and easy runs!

A stunning course in a beautiful part of Eryri - Snowdonia National Park, at the foot of Cadair Idris. The hamlet of Tal Y Llyn is nestled on the shores of Llyn Mwyngil, a beautiful glacial ribbon lake.


The Breakdown

Each lap has a total of 1.4km of running and 800m of swimming. A potential of 6 laps covering 13.2km of awesome swimrunning.

Swim 1: 300m

Run 1: 750m

Swim 2: 500m

Run 2: 650m

 

The Lap Times

Lap 1: 28 min

Lap 2: 26 min

Lap 3: 24 min

Lap 4: 22 min

Lap 5: 21 min

Lap 6: Just go!

 

Swim Exit 1

Was a relatively easy slope out of the lake.


Swim Exit 2

Was a gentle slope out of the lake.


Swim Entry

Unusually for swimrun this as an in-water start! There is just one swim entry, which involves stepping down from the pavement into the lake.


Apart from the two swim exit points (very short sections of trail), the running was on a hard surface (paving/tarmac) and was flat.
